1995 | 1997
Jet Grouting cut-off wall for the construction of the upstream cofferdam - over 30 m of water head - interpenetrated columns on 1 or 2 lines - Ø 1500÷2500 mm diameter - over 65 m depth - wall's total thickness from 0,8 to 1,6 m - extensive verify et test program - quality controls during construction, including the continuous monitoring of Jet Grouting parameters by a real time data collecting system, the inclinometric measure of every bore verticality, coring, permeability measure and pumping test at the end of operations - maximum permeability 1x10-6 cm/sec - unconfined compressive strength 2 MPa at 28 days
SM3 Hydroelectric Complex Project | SEPT ILES (Quebec - Canada)
